The book explores the dangerous consequences of hateful thoughts and language, specifically referencing the 2019 terrorist attack on mosques in Christchurch, New Zealand. It argues that while governments in free societies cannot regulate individual beliefs, they have an obligation to safeguard citizens from harmful communications that incite discrimination and violence. This examination highlights the delicate balance between freedom of expression and the protection of public safety in democratic contexts.
